Jefferson White returned to Yellowstone in the final season (Season 5 Part 2) in fall 2024, bringing with him renewed questions about what’s going on with the reported Yellowstone spinoff, 6666 (pronounced four sixes). Based on the ranch that White’s Yellowstone character, Jimmy Hurdstrom, moved to in Yellowstone Season 4, 6666 is said to be on the horizon for Taylor Sheridan‘s TV universe.
It’s been a long time since there have been any meaningful updates about the series since it was announced by Paramount in February 2021. Two prequels and three present-day spinoffs have been released and announced in the time since — 1883, 1923, Y: Marshals, the Beth and Rip series, and The Madison — and there’s reportedly another prequel, 1944, in the works. ‘Yellowstone’ Actor Jefferson White Comments on Future of ‘6666’ Spinoff
As the Yellowstone universe expanded, it became evident that viewers wanted to know more about Jimmy and how he learnt what it meant to be a cowboy at 6666 Ranch. At the time, it was announced that a 6666 spin-off was in development, with Jimmy set to return as one of its primary characters. However, as time passed, there was no official update from Paramount about whether the project was still in development.
Well, folks, we knew this day might come: 6666 Yellowstone spinoffs might not be happening after all. In a recent interview with the Daily Mail, Yellowstone actor Jefferson White (Jimmy) hinted that 6666, a show teased since 2022, seems unlikely.
During a conversation that centered around working with Kevin Costner, the DM team asked Jefferson for any word on what’s next for the Yellowstone universe—namely, if we can expect him to reprise his role as Jimmy anytime soon.
“Not that I know of now,” he admitted. “I kept my fingers crossed, but also, I’d be grateful if I got to do more, and I’m grateful for what I got to do. I don’t want to be selfish. We got a lot of great mileage out of that show.’
While Jefferson doesn’t seem fully fazed by the unknown future of the series, fans are split by the news.
